Reverend Billy and The Church of Stop Shopping has established a permanent creative home at 36 Avenue C (Loisaida Ave., corner of E. 3rd Street), where the troupe will evolve new works and perform weekly on Sundays at 3:00 PM. The location, renamed Earthchxrch, is a former bank branch (first North Fork, then Capital One).
